Marvin J. Fine is a scholar working on Clinical Psychology, Developmental and Educational Psychology and Education. According to data from OpenAlex, Marvin J. Fine has authored 53 papers receiving a total of 619 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 33 papers in Clinical Psychology, 18 papers in Developmental and Educational Psychology and 16 papers in Education. Recurrent topics in Marvin J. Fine’s work include Child and Adolescent Psychosocial and Emotional Development (17 papers), Behavioral and Psychological Studies (12 papers) and Family and Disability Support Research (11 papers). Marvin J. Fine is often cited by papers focused on Child and Adolescent Psychosocial and Emotional Development (17 papers), Behavioral and Psychological Studies (12 papers) and Family and Disability Support Research (11 papers). Marvin J. Fine collaborates with scholars based in United States. Marvin J. Fine's co-authors include Nona Tollefson, John P. Poggio, Debra Bendell, Patricia L. White, Thomas E. Caldwell, Anne Gardner, Eric Robinson, Katherine Green, Donald J. Treffinger and Seymour Epstein and has published in prestigious journals such as American Psychologist, Journal of Learning Disabilities and Journal of School Psychology.
